flag Canadian rents grew only 2.1% YoY in September, the slowest since Oct 2021, with declines in Ontario and BC, and a rise in Saskatchewan.

flag In September, Canadian rents grew only 2.1% year-over-year, the slowest rate since October 2021, averaging $2,193. flag This marks five months of declining growth due to a significant drop in foreign student enrollments. flag Ontario and British Columbia saw the largest declines in rents, with decreases of 4.3% and 3.2%, respectively. flag Conversely, Saskatchewan experienced a notable 23.5% increase in rental prices, while rents fell in major cities like Vancouver and Toronto.
